Use Fabrikat, our in-house test-data factory. Define a blueprint once, then call `Fabrikat.build("customer")` and you get a fully populated object with sensible defaults. Need overrides? Pass a dict and only those fields change. Please don't hand-roll fixtures anymore — Fabrikat keeps schemas in sync automatically when models change. Blueprints live in `tests/blueprints/`, and the wiki page "Fabrikat 101" covers sequences and traits. Still stuck after that? Drop a note to the testing guild at the address below.

escalation mailbox, yajeg-bageg: quenax.olidor@lumiccorp.internal

Test plan: migrate from legacy QueueSmith to Railhopper. Phase 1: shadow-run both queues, compare job completion counts hourly. Phase 2: cut 10% of traffic, watch retry rates. Rollback trigger: >0.5% job loss or p95 latency doubling. Sign-off needed from release manager before phase 2. All verification scripts run against the Railhopper staging cluster and authenticate with the bearer token below.

bearer token for fahap-taduf: eyJhbGciOiJIUzI1NiIsInR5cCI6IkpXVCJ9.eyJzdWIiOiIdb2jwwh2M-In0.jQLm6X5pZ7uw

## Authentication

Heads up: the nightly reindex job (`reindex_nightly.py`) talks to the Lanternfish search cluster, and that cluster won't accept anonymous writes anymore — we locked it down last sprint. The job now authenticates as the `reindex-runner` service identity against Corvid Gateway, and the token is injected via the `LF_INDEX_TOKEN` env var in the scheduler config. Nothing clever going on, just a bearer header on every batch request. For review purposes, the staging credential currently in use is listed below.

service key, kadug-kadup: kto15_rN23XLAYImmZgrJ

RUNBOOK — Kiosk account recovery, Plimworth terminals

When the Dornick watchdog restarts the kiosk app more than three times in ten minutes, it locks the local operator account as a safety measure. To restore access, hold the service button for five seconds, select Recovery, and carefully enter the passphrase shown below exactly as written.

strongbox words: praath-queniel-holax-druael-jorath-noveth-druok